Local performers join together to present, Inspiration, a concert benefiting the *Howe Sound Music Festival. This hour-long recital provides an engaging variety of music from music teachers and past HSMFestival success stories. Children, students, and music lovers of all ages are sure to enjoy the vocal and piano selections spanning classical, musical theatre and jazz genres.
*Now in its 12th year, the Howe Sound Music Festival is produced by the Howe Sound Performing Arts Association. The adjudicated music festival is open to residents in the Howe Sound Corridor.
